End Of Road For Ministerial Lobbyists: Final List Drops

By Frank Amponsah

The President, Nana Akufo-Addo has put an end to Deputy Regional Ministerial portfolios thereby putting an end to all lobbying efforts for the positions.

This, according to information is part of the President’s move to downsize his government in his second term in office.

Also, the President has scrapped seven Ministries which he thinks are done with their work and do not need to have a Ministry.
Meanwhile, the list presented by the President to Parliament consists of Thirty (30) Ministers and Sixteen (16) Regional Ministers with eight female Ministers and two of them being Regional Ministers.

Meanwhile, seven Ministries including Aviation, Business Development, Inner City and Zongo Development, Monitoring and Evaluation, Planning, Regional Re-organization and Development, and Special Development Initiatives have been realigned.

According to earlier information from the Office of the President, activities of the Inner City and Zongo Development Ministry are to be brought under the Presidency, with a Co-ordinator appointed to supervise, as well as exercise oversight responsibility over the Zongo Development Fund whilst the newly-renamed Ministry of Local Government, Decentralization and Rural Development will be tasked with overseeing the outstanding activities of the erstwhile Regional Re-organization and Development Ministry.

Matters to do with the Special Development Initiatives Ministry will be coordinated from the Presidency, as will be those of the Monitoring and Evaluation Ministry.

The President, Nana Akufo-Addo in view of the appointments held one-on-one meetings with the new Ministers-designate, as well as with his first-term Ministers who will not transition into the new government, to break the news to them on Wednesday, 20th January, and Thursday, 21st January,

President Akufo-Addo congratulated the new ministers on their nominations, and expressed his expectation that they will be promptly approved by Parliament, to allow them to start work forthwith.

To the former Ministers, the President assured them of possible roles to be played in the larger governmental structure, and wished them the best of luck in their future undertakings.
